I thought I would start with a Black & White Halloween. I have really been into the Moon Pumpkins the past couple of years. There is just something so ghostly about them. If you can't find any you can just paint the regular one white and you can write on them or put pictures on them.

 I love this hall arrangement in black & white. Very classy yet spooky.



   Love, love, love these dancing spirit dresses. I know I had them on last Halloween's posts but they are so lovely I posted them again. I will do this one year. Very simple just molded chicken wire.


 These pumpkins are so delightful. Just get out the paint and use your imagination.


What a lovely entranceway. Just cut out some bats and use whatever you have that is black & white, gorgeous.



I am definately painting a black pumpkin this year.  How delicously spooky!




Oh, Halloween dishes! I have bought a few but these are amazing! Why not really go all out and have sets of Halloween dishes just like Christmas dishes.




 Now anyone can do this. Just some old frames and shutters and switch to a black shade.



 Did you ever make Christmas Trees out of old phone books when you were little? I did and this is a great idea for a project for your kids, a recycled book pumpkin!
